What is a Parrot Rescue Center?
A parrot rescue center is a specialized facility committed to the rehab, care, and placement of deserted, abused, or gave up parrots. These centers focus on the well-being of the birds, offering them with a safe environment, healthcare, Kaufen Graupapagei and the chance for socialization and enrichment. Furthermore, numerous rescue centers aim to educate the general public about accountable family pet ownership and the truths of parrot care.

Parrot rescue centers operate under numerous obstacles that can impact their efficiency. Understanding these obstacles is crucial for valuing their work:

Limited Resources: Many rescue centers count on contributions and volunteers, which may not always be sufficient to cover the costs of food, treatment, and facility upkeep.

Overpopulation: Verhalten Von Graupapageien The high variety of surrendered and abandoned parrots often exceeds the centers' capacity, causing overcrowded centers and restricted individual attention for each bird.

Public Awareness: Despite their efforts, lots of people remain uninformed of the challenges faced by parrots in the pet trade and the value of embracing rather than acquiring birds.

Legal Challenges: Some areas have inadequate laws to protect parrots from prohibited capture and trade, making it challenging for rescue centers to promote effectively.

Beyond supplying immediate care, parrot rescue centers contribute significantly to the wider effort of parrot conservation. Their work can be classified into several essential areas:
1. Rehab and Reintroduction
Some parrot rescue centers are included in rehab programs for injured or ill birds with the goal of reintroducing them into the wild when possible. This process requires substantial knowledge of bird habits and the local environment.
2. Education and Advocacy
Education is an important component of preservation. Parrot rescue centers frequently host workshops and community occasions to notify the general public about the ethical implications of bird ownership. They also promote for more powerful guidelines protecting parrots both in the wild and in captivity.
3. Research Contributions
Lots of rescue centers take part in research initiatives that collect valuable data on parrot behavior, health, and breeding. This research study can aid in the conservation of wild populations and enhance hostage care requirements.

A1: Parrot rescue centers typically look after a variety of types, including however not limited to cockatiels, macaws, amazons, and African greys. Each species has unique requirements and habits.
Q2: How can I embrace a parrot from a rescue center?
A2: The adoption procedure varies by center however generally involves an application, an interview, and a home visit to guarantee a good match between you and the parrot.
Q3: Are parrots appropriate family pets for everybody?
A3: Parrots can be wonderful buddies, but they require significant time, attention, and specialized care. Potential owners should look into particular species and consider their way of life before adopting.
Q4: Do parrot rescue centers provide medical care for the birds?
A4: Yes, lots of rescue centers have veterinary partnerships or on-site vets to supply required medical care, vaccinations, and routine health check-ups for their birds.
Q5: What can I do if I discover a hurt or deserted parrot?
A5: If you experience an injured or abandoned parrot, get in touch with a regional rescue center or wildlife rehabilitation center right away. They can provide guidance on steps to take for the bird's security.
